The Digital Advantage: How the Digital Crosshairs Works
The Digital Crosshairs Adaptive Rifle Scope Clip-on is a advanced piece of assistive tools for hunting. It attaches to the eyepiece of a standard rifle scope, transforming it right into a easy to use system specifically designed for seekers with reduced vision or total blindness.

Right here's just how it works:

Digital Show: The clip-on features a high-resolution LCD show that jobs a clear picture from the scope's objective lens. This image can be magnified and adjusted to enhance visibility for people with visual impairments.
Precise Crosshairs: Unlike conventional scopes, the Digital Crosshairs forecasts a digital reticle straight onto the display. This reticle can be tailored in size, color, and illumination to further maximize the aiming experience for the individual.
Boosted Exposure: Some designs boast night vision capacities, enabling hunters to see clearly in low-light conditions. This expands hunting chances for individuals with visual impairments that may have previously been limited to daytime hunting.
